Leon Thomas has officially released the highly anticipated remix of his song “MUTT,” featuring R&B star Chris Brown. This collaboration marks the first time the two artists have worked together on a track, although Thomas has previously written for Brown behind the scenes. The remix follows a teaser that Thomas shared during a concert on March 14, building excitement among fans for this musical pairing.
